Key Responsibilities

Finance Support

  • Raise and manage Purchase Orders accurately and in a timely manner, ensuring compliance with internal controls, financial procedures, and contractual requirements
  • Process invoices through MySpend/Coupa, maintaining organised financial documentation and audit trails in line with Swiss Re policies
  • Monitor open purchase orders and invoices, proactively following up with requestors, approvers, and suppliers to minimise delays and ensure timely payment
  • Collaborate with Finance, Procurement, vendors, and internal stakeholders to support efficient purchasing processes and resolve financial administration issues

Administration Support

  • Manage Snow tickets in collaboration with Facility Management Support Officers (FMSOs)
  • Maintain workplace data in IWMS/Planon, ensuring accuracy and up-to-date records
  • Coordinate Health & Safety tasks, including Display Screen Equipment (DSE) assessments, first aid and fire marshal training
  • Support legal compliance, Internal Environmental Management (IEM) topics, and ISO certifications (e.g., ISO14001, ISO50001)
  • Actively contribute to team meetings by preparing updates, taking accurate notes, recording agreed actions, and distributing follow-up items in a timely manner

Communication Support

  • Create and distribute Service Communication Messages (SCOM) via ContactOne
  • Coordinate poster distribution and support event-related communications
  • Maintain and update CRES information on ContactOne and the Enterprise portal

Project Support

  • Support CRES projects including vendor management, coordination of site visits, meeting minutes, and ongoing tool improvements (e.g., meeting room booking and visitor registration tools)
  • Maintain organised project records of discussions, decisions, and follow-up actions to support effective delivery and team visibility

Relationship Management

  • Act as a key contact for multisite suppliers and vendors, including Fruitful Office, Lyreco, and St John Ambulance
  • Attend supplier, subtenant, and internal team meetings, contributing constructively, capturing key discussion points, and ensuring agreed actions are followed through
  • Work collaboratively with colleagues, suppliers, and stakeholders to deliver a consistent, professional, and service-focused workplace experience

About Swiss Re

Swiss Re is one of the world’s leading providers of reinsurance, insurance and other forms of insurance-based risk transfer, working to make the world more resilient. We anticipate and manage a wide variety of risks, from natural catastrophes and climate change to cybercrime. Combining experience with creative thinking and cutting-edge expertise, we create new opportunities and solutions for our clients. This is possible thanks to the collaboration of more than 15,000 employees across the world.
